The document discusses using Excel for advanced applications in early drug development. It describes both the advantages and limitations of Excel, and provides examples of automated macros developed in Excel to analyze assay data from various laboratory instruments and calculate parameters. These include macros for analyzing ELogD, solubility, and stability data. It also discusses best practices for developing specifications for such macros and techniques like outlier removal and widening search windows to make the macros more flexible and tolerant of small variations in data.
